Ziemiełowice [ʑɛmjɛwɔˈvit͡sɛ] (German Simmelwitz)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Namysłów, within Namysłów County, Opole Voivodeship, in south-western Poland.[1] It lies approximately 4 kilometres (2 mi) south-east of Namysłów and 45 km (28 mi) north of the regional capital Opole.

Before 1945 the area was part of Germany (see Territorial changes of Poland after World War II).
